XC7A100T-3CS324E Overview



The XC7A100T-3CS324E chip model is an advanced FPGA (Field Programmable Gate Array) solution from Xilinx. It is designed to meet the needs of high-performance, cost-effective, and power-efficient applications in the modern communication industry.


The XC7A100T-3CS324E model is an ideal choice for advanced communication systems. It offers an array of features and capabilities, such as high-speed transceivers, high-performance memory, and advanced logic blocks. The chip model also provides a high level of programmability and flexibility, making it suitable for a wide range of applications.
